Delta Air Lines Sponsors Supplier Diversity Exchange; Focus On Small, Minority And Women-Owned Businesses

Published 05-02-00

Submitted by Delta Air Lines

Delta Air Lines (NYSE:DAL) will sponsor the second Annual Supplier Diversity "Procurement" Exchange on Tuesday, May 9, from 1:00 p.m. - 5:00 p.m. (EDT) at Delta’s Worldwide Headquarters. This event features a general session and business marketplace to bring together Delta Purchasing representatives, first-tier suppliers and other major corporations with small, minority and women-owned businesses.

Edward H. West, Delta’s executive vice president and CFO, will speak on Delta’s business operations and the on-going commitment to supplier diversity. "The Exchange provides a great setting to share our corporate strategies and goals, with an opportunity to network," said West. "Last year more than 250 people attended this event, and we expect to surpass that number during this Exchange."

Delta has received several awards over the past few years for its supplier diversity efforts. The awards include 1998 Corporation of the Year, 1997 Advocate of the Year and the 1997 Crystal Award from the Georgia Minority Supplier Development Council.

Delta is a member of the National Minority Supplier Development Council and organizations such as the Women Business Enterprise National Council (WBENC), the Atlanta Hispanic Chamber of Commerce, the Native American Business Alliance and the Asian Business Association.
